Abstract
PURPOSE: To assess knowledge retention of physicians after participating in a webinar series and its perceived benefits on daily practice and career development.Entities:
Keywords: Continuing medical education; Knowledge retention; Physicians; Professional development; Videoconference

Undergraduate and/or general practitioner education level refers to participants who had graduated with either bachelor of medicine or doctor of medicine (M.D.). In Indonesia, M.D. with a practicing license is equivalent to the general practitioner level. Postgraduate education level refers to participants who graduated with higher qualifications, including specialist physicians, consultants, physicians with a master’s degree, and physicians with Ph.D.
Examples of physicians who do not work in a health facility include those who work in governmental offices, universities, insurance companies, and telemedicine platforms.
